Chesterfield County Fair Association Scholarship Award

The Chesterfield County Fair Association, Inc. is offering two $1,000 scholarships to be awarded to individuals seeking a formal education beyond high school.

Eligibility requirements:

The applicant must be a citizen of the U.S., a resident of Chesterfield County and never been convicted of a criminal offense.

The applicant can be of any age as long as he/she is a graduating high school senior with a cumulative grade point average of 2.0 or higher (a”C” average) or have received a GED within one year of submission of an application for the scholarship.

Applications must be postmarked between January 15 and April 1.

The scholarship is not based on sex, race, religion, financial need, class rank or scholastic major.

Membership in the Chesterfield County Fair Association, Inc., is not required but candidates who are members of the association will be given preference.

Participation in the Chesterfield County Fair is not required but a strong preference will be given to those who have in some way worked at the fair.

An award decision will be made by May 1 of the year in which the award is to be made and payment will take place upon proof of acceptance and enrollment in a program of post secondary education.

The goal of the Chesterfield County Fair Association, Inc., through these scholarships, is to help prepare a better future for Chesterfield County and its residents.

In order to be considered for this scholarship each applicant must meet the above requirements and must submit a copy of the attached application.  If short-answer questions or the essay question cannot be answered in the space provided, use of additional paper is acceptable.  A copy of applicant’s official transcript from his/her school is also required.  While a letter of recommendation is not required, if submitted it must be included with the application. 

Before submission of the application please review for legibility, grammar, punctuation and spelling.  A completed application, along with any documentation, should be sent to:
